Auto Locksmith Key Programming: A Comprehensive Guide
In today's world, the operation of cars relies greatly on sophisticated technologies, consisting of smart keys and keyless entry systems. As a result, auto locksmith key programming has actually ended up being a vital service for vehicle owners and automotive specialists. This post intends to supply an in-depth understanding of auto locksmith key programming, including its significance, processes, tools used, and regularly asked questions.
What is Auto Locksmith Key Programming?
Auto locksmith key programming describes the strategies utilized by locksmith professionals to produce, replace, or duplicate electronic keys for lorries. As automobiles are significantly integrated with advanced electronic systems, the programming of keys has progressed to accommodate these improvements. Conventional metal keys have actually been replaced or supplemented with smart keys or transponders that need specific programming to work.
Significance of Key Programming
Key programming is essential for numerous factors:
Security: Modern cars employ key file encryption for boosted security. A configured key makes sure that only the designated vehicle owner can access and start their car.
Convenience: Key programming permits the advancement of keyless entry systems, allowing drivers to unlock their vehicles without the traditional key.
Replacement: Losing or damaging a key can be a trouble. Efficient key programming services provide quick replacements, decreasing disturbances.
The Key Programming Process
The process of auto locksmith key programming can vary based upon the kind of key and vehicle. Here are the general steps included:
Assessment: The locksmith will take a look at the vehicle's make, model, and year and figure out the type of key needed.
Key Extraction: If a key is harmed or requires to be replaced, the locksmith may extract the needed information from the ignition system or the vehicle's onboard diagnostics.
Key Generation: The locksmith will create a new key using dedicated software application and devices created for the specific vehicle.
Programming: Using a specialized programming tool, the locksmith programs the brand-new key to recognize the vehicle's immobilizer system. This step is vital to make sure the key can begin the vehicle.
Evaluating: After programming, the locksmith will test the new key to ensure it works correctly with the vehicle and validates successful programming.
Tools Used in Key Programming
Auto locksmiths use a range of tools to perform key programming effectively. A few of the important tools consist of:
Tool Type | Purpose |
---|---|
Key Cutting Machines | To cut new keys properly based upon specifications. |
OBD-II Scanners | To interface with the vehicle's onboard computer for programming. |
Key Programmers | Specialized gadgets to connect the key with the vehicle's immobilizer system. |
Diagnostic Software | Utilized to diagnose problems with the vehicle's key system. |
Transponder Chips | Used in developing brand-new keys that work with the vehicle's electronics. |
Kinds of Keys
Keys can be categorized into several types based on their innovation:
Traditional Keys: Mechanical keys with no electronic components.
Transponder Keys: Contain a chip that interacts with the vehicle's immobilizer to enable starting.
Smart Keys: Key fobs that enable keyless entry and ignition without the requirement for physical insertion into the lock.
Remote Keyless Entry: Enables vehicle access and control functions from another location.
Common Problems and Solutions
In spite of the reliability of key programming, numerous problems can develop. Here are some common issues and their solutions:
Failed Programming: If a freshly set key does not start the vehicle, it might be due to an inaccurate approach by the locksmith. In such cases, reprogramming may be necessary.
Dead Key Fob Battery: If a smart key stops working, it may merely require a new battery, instead of reprogramming.
Damaged Immobilizer System: If the vehicle's immobilizer system is malfunctioning, it will require to be checked and repaired before programming a key.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. The length of time does the key programming procedure take?
The period of key programming can vary however usually takes between 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the vehicle's intricacy and the key type.
2. Can I set my own key?
While some vehicles enable owners to program their own keys, it typically needs special devices and understanding. It is suggested to work with an expert locksmith for finest results.
3. What should I do if I lose my key?
If you lose your key, the very first step is to call a reliable auto locksmith who can evaluate your vehicle and offer a replacement key.
4. Is key programming pricey?
The cost of key programming can differ widely based on the vehicle design, key type, and local market rates. Usually, it might range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 300.
